Outsourcing Best Practices: IT Procurement Strategies

Chicago, IL | June 7, 2007
Choose a webcast from the list below

Peter George, Baker & McKenzie In this seminar we'll explore how top CIO's and IT executives support the extended enterprise model while maintaining control over their projects, budgets, compliance risks, & corporate objectives. Following are the sessions you'll experience as a participant in the event:

      • Learn from a keynote panel of top CIO's and IT executives how they successfully use external IT Procurement & Project Management Strategies in an era of the Extended Enterprise
      • Receive an executive briefing on the top trends facing the Extended Enterprise today
      • Learn how companies manage the risk and complexity of compliant sourcing in an era where suppliers are willing to accept responsibility
      • In a Framework for the Outsourcing Decision process, you'll learn how to identify your companies core competencies and determine which areas to outsource and how IT can thrive in this environment
      • In Making Global Work, Work you'll learn how to take advantage of the opportunities of global outsourcing, while minimizing the risk

1:30–1:55 Compliant Sourcing for the Extended Enterprise
Outsourcing Webcast: Compliant Sourcing for the Extended Enterprise
Peter George, Baker & McKenzie Peter George, Partner, Baker & McKenzie
Mr. George has prepared numerous short articles on marketing and protecting software, computer and telecommunication products and services, as well as outsourcing. He has a special focus on counseling both providers and users in domestic and multi-jurisdictional outsourcing and offshoring transactions, from managed IT services to business process deals involving human resources, finance and accounting and facilities management. Mr. George advises information technology companies on various aspects of their domestic and foreign operations.
1:55–2:20 Emerging Trends in Global Outsourcing
Outsourcing Webcast: Emerging Trends in Global Outsourcing
Amit Gupta, HCL America Amit Gupta, Associate Vice President, HCL America
Amit Gupta is an Associate Vice President and Head of Mid-West Geo for HCL Technologies. He also leads HCL’s Hi-Tech and Manufacturing vertical for the Mid-West region. Amit was responsible for pioneering HCL's “Technology Development Offshoring” concept and building its Technology Services outsourcing practice. He also pioneered and built a multi-service integrated IT outsourcing practice which culminated into a $50 Million End to End multi-service IT Outsourcing deal, the first of its kind for an India based outsourcing Company.

4:00–4:50 Keynote Panel: IT Procurement Strategies in an Era of the Extended Enterprise
Moderator:
Don Versen, Manager, Managed Services, Sun Microsystems
Don leverages 18 years of experience the IT Managed Services industryin his role as Manager for Sun's Managed Services practice in the Midwest Area. Don has management responsibility for Sun's services and selective sourcing engagements delivered by Sun and its partners. His past experience includes Manager of Customer Care and Network Operations Centers for IBM Global Services and Director of Product
Management for AT&T Managed Hosting and Business Services.
Bill Chmaberlain, Hewitt Bill Chamberlain, Director, Hewitt Associates
Bill has eighteen years of information technology experience in the human resource industry. He has played a variety of roles in Hewitt's Consulting and Outsourcing segments building and leading global application development, information management, and business intelligence teams. Over the last seven years, Bill helped build multiple development teams in India including one of Hewitt's first offshore captive teams. Bill is responsible for information delivery for some of Hewitt's HR BPO clients and utilizes teams in North America and India.
Shouvik Dutta, Hart Schaffner Marx Shouvik Dutta, VP/CIO, Hart Schaffner Marx
Shouvik is the VP of IT, responsible for integrating and managing the diverse requirements of Hart Schaffner Marx a premier Apparel company. He is currently managing a large initiative, transforming the business and technology at Hart Marx. He has built global teams, managed the outsourcing of application and technology.  He has managed global sourcing and delivery initiatives for the last ten years.
Kurt Conrath, Motorola Kurt Conrath, Director Corporate IT, Motorola
Kurt has been a leader at Motorola for 22 years, working in Robotics Engineering, Product Development, Quality, Program Management and IT.  For the last four years, Kurt has filled a principal role in the oversight and governance of a major IT infrastructure support services outsourcing agreement.  During that time, he has specialized in Service Level Management, New Projects/Contract Extensions, and governance processes.  Kurt brings a pragmatic approach to IT sourcing strategy and the business of running IT.
  Mark Schlander, Managed Services Executive, IBM
Mark is responsible for Strategic Outsourcing, Applications On Demand, Managed Business Process Services, and On Demand Hosting Services, over 1000 clients are supported with these solutions. Mark is a high energy, results oriented leader with a successful career in managing client engagements globally.
